Across TCGA patient cohorts, PYCR1 protein abundance is significantly associated with the RNA expression of many other genes, with 12,583 significant associations in total. LUAD sh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ible PYCR1-associated genes across cancer lineages are GAPT, CLEC9A, and MFNG. Each is linked with PYCR1 in more than 6 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both PYCR1-to-partner and partner-to-PYCR1 results are reported.

Each partner links to its own Q-omics profile. The scatter plot shows the strongest example, PYCR1 versus GAPT in COAD, with a Pearson correlation of -0.34.
